Apparatus, system, and method for protecting electronic devices in a virtual perimeter

US9489545B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9489545-B2
Application numberUS-201514731831-A
CountryUS
Kind codeB2
Filing dateJun 5, 2015
Priority dateNov 10, 2011
Publication dateNov 8, 2016
Grant dateNov 8, 2016

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Described herein are apparatus, system, and method for protecting electronic devices through the creation of a virtual perimeter among the electronic devices. The virtual perimeter may be generated by the electronic devices themselves. The method performed by an electronic device comprises: identifying a current context; receiving a role, according to the current context, in a hierarchy of multiple electronic devices, and operating in accordance with the role in the hierarchy within a secure perimeter in the current context around the multiple electronic devices, wherein the hierarchy includes a system of security checks based on context information.

First claim

Opening claim text (preview).

We claim: 1. At least one machine-readable storage medium having computer executable instructions stored thereon that, when executed, cause an electronic device to perform a method, the method comprising: identifying a current context; receiving a role as a primary element among multiple electronic devices for the current context; operating in accordance with the role within a secure perimeter in the current context around the multiple electronic devices; periodically checking conformity with one or more context rules for each of electronic device among the multiple electronic devices; and triggering an event when a context rule is activated. 2. The at least one machine-readable storage medium of claim 1 , wherein the event comprises the primary element deactivating each of the multiple electronic devices. 3. The at least one machine-readable storage medium of claim 1 , having further computer executable instructions stored thereon that, when executed, cause the electronic device to perform a further method, the further method comprising identifying the primary element. 4. The at least one machine-readable storage medium of claim 3 , wherein identifying the primary element comprises: receiving assignment as the primary element; and electing, as the primary element, one or more electronic devices from among the multiple electronic devices. 5. The at least one machine-readable storage medium of claim 3 , wherein identifying the primary element comprises executing, in view of the current context, an election algorithm to identify the primary element. 6. The at least one machine-readable storage medium of claim 1 , wherein the event comprises performing one or more of: securely shutting down itself or at least one of the electronic devices that causes triggering of the event; synchronizing data with another machine; shutting down all the multiple electronic devices in the hierarchy; locking-in itself or at least one of the electronic device in the hierarchy that causes triggering of the event; and activating anti-theft protocol for itself or for at least one of the electronic device in the hierarchy. 7. The at least one machine-readable storage medium of claim 6 , wherein the other machine is a cloud computing unit, and wherein synchronizing with the other machine comprises copying data to the cloud computing unit. 8. The at least one machine-readable storage medium of claim 2 , wherein all electronic devices, among the multiple electronic devices, are shut down when the primary element triggers an event indicating that the primary element is outside the secure perimeter. 9. The at least one machine-readable storage medium of claim 1 , wherein the context information comprises one or more of: physical proximity between electronic devices; logical location of the electronic devices; movement of an electronic device relative to other electronic devices; strength of wireless internet connectivity of an electronic device relative to other electronic devices; an event detected by soft or hard sensors of an electronic device; and a message received from another electronic device, the message to indicate an event in the current context. 10. An electronic device comprising: one of more processors to execute: a logic unit to identify a current context; and a security agent to receive a role as a primary element among multiple electronic devices for the current context, operate in accordance with the role within a secure perimeter in the current context around the multiple electronic devices, periodically check conformity with one or more context rules for each of electronic device among the multiple electronic devices; and trigger an event when a context rule is activated. 11. The electronic device of claim 10 , wherein the security agent comprises a context awareness engine for receiving context information from other electronic devices among the multiple electronic devices. 12. The electronic device of claim 11 , wherein the context information comprises one or more of: physical proximity between electronic devices in the hierarchy; logical location; movement relative to other electronic devices in the hierarchy; strength of wireless internet connectivity relative to other electronic devices in the hierarchy; an event detected by soft or hard sensors; and a message received from another electronic device in the hierarchy, the message to indicate an event in the current context. 13. The electronic device of claim 11 , wherein the context awareness engine includes an agent rule to cause an event to trigger when the agent rule is activated. 14. The electronic device of claim 13 , wherein the event, triggered when the agent rule is activated, comprises one or more of: secure shut down of itself or at least one of the electronic device from among the multiple electronic devices in the hierarchy that causes the triggering of the event; synchronize data with another machine; shut down all the multiple electronic devices in the hierarchy; lock-in of itself or at least one of the electronic device from among the multiple electronic devices in the hierarchy that causes the triggering of the event; and activate anti-theft protocol for itself or at least one of the electronic device from among the multiple electronic devices in the hierarchy. 15. A server comprising: a processor executing a security manager module to: register multiple electronic devices; define one or more contexts for the registered multiple electronic devices for providing a secure perimeter in the one or more contexts around the multiple electronic devices; and identify a primary element of the multiple electronic devices for the current context using an election algorithm. 16. The server of claim 15 , wherein the security manager module defines context rules for triggering an event by each of the electronic devices among the multiple electronic devices, defines the hierarchy by registering one or more electronic devices among the multiple electronic devices as a primary element in the hierarchy, receives data from the primary element electronic device in response to triggering of an event, and receives data for registering and administering configuration of the multiple electronic devices. 17. The server of claim 16 , wherein the security manager module is communicatively coupled to a security agent of the primary element electronic device. 18. The server of claim 16 , wherein the security manager module registers one or more electronic devices as the primary element by performing one or more of: assigning one or more electronic devices, from among the multiple electronic device, as the top element; receiving an input from one or more electronic devices, among the multiple electronic devices, that elected the top element from among the multiple electronic devices; and executing, in view of the context, a leader election algorithm to identify the top element. 19. The server of claim 15 , wherein the security agent includes a context awareness engine for receiving context information from other electronic devices among the multiple electronic devices. 20. The server of claim 19 , wherein the context information comprises one or more of: physical proximity between electronic devices in the hierarchy; logical location of the electronic devices in the hierarchy; movement of an electronic device relative to other electronic devices in the hierarchy; strength of wireless internet connectivity of an electronic d

Assignees

Inventors

Classifications

  • Access rights, e.g. capability lists, access control lists, access tables, access matrices · CPC title

  • Restricted operating environment · CPC title

  • Inheriting rights or properties, e.g., propagation of permissions or restrictions within a hierarchy · CPC title

  • G06F21/88Primary

    Detecting or preventing theft or loss · CPC title

  • H04W12/08Primary

    Access security ·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9489545B2 cover?
Described herein are apparatus, system, and method for protecting electronic devices through the creation of a virtual perimeter among the electronic devices. The virtual perimeter may be generated by the electronic devices themselves. The method performed by an electronic device comprises: identifying a current context; receiving a role, according to the current context, in a hierarchy of mult…
Who is the assignee on this patent?
Intel Corp
What technology area does this patent fall under?
Primary CPC classification G06F21/88.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Nov 08 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).